com.softslate.commerce.administrator.core
Class BaseSerializableForm
java.lang.Object
org.apache.struts.action.ActionForm
com.softslate.commerce.administrator.core.BaseSerializableForm
- All Implemented Interfaces:
- java.io.Serializable
- Direct Known Subclasses:
- AdministratorForm, AttributeForm, BasicTaxForm, CategoryForm, CountryForm, CustomerAddressForm, CustomerForm, DiscountForm, DiscountRangeForm, ImportForm, ManagerGetOrderXMLForm, ManufacturerForm, OptionForm, OrderDeliveryForm, OrderDiscountForm, OrderForm, OrderItemAttributeForm, OrderItemForm, PaymentForm, ProductForm, RoleForm, ShippingMethodForm, ShippingRateForm, ShippingRuleForm, ShippingRuleRangeForm, SKUForm, StateForm, UserSettingForm
public class BaseSerializableForm
- extends org.apache.struts.action.ActionForm
- implements java.io.Serializable
Provides a number of properties common to forms representing the initial
control panel screen for a database table in the administrator. This class is
serializable so that the control screen form settings can be maintained
through the user's session.
- Author:
- David Tobey
- See Also:
- Serialized Form
Fields inherited from class org.apache.struts.action.ActionForm |
multipartRequestHandler, servlet |
Methods inherited from class org.apache.struts.action.ActionForm |
getMultipartRequestHandler, getServlet, getServletWrapper, reset, reset, setMultipartRequestHandler, setServlet, validate, validate |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
serialVersionUID
private static final long serialVersionUID
- See Also:
- Constant Field Values
log
static org.apache.commons.logging.Log log
idField
private java.lang.String idField
nameField
private java.lang.String nameField
childName
private java.lang.String childName
m2mChild
private boolean m2mChild
idValues
private java.lang.String[] idValues
idIntegers
private java.lang.Integer[] idIntegers
parentIDField
private java.lang.String parentIDField
parentID
private java.lang.String parentID
parentKey
private java.lang.String parentKey
manyToManyKey
private java.lang.String manyToManyKey
manyToManyProp
private java.lang.String manyToManyProp
manyToManyClass
private java.lang.String manyToManyClass
joinManyToManyParent
private java.lang.String joinManyToManyParent
entity
private java.lang.Class entity
parentProperty
private java.lang.String parentProperty
entityProperty
private java.lang.String entityProperty
grandparentIDField
private java.lang.String grandparentIDField
greatGrandparentIDField
private java.lang.String greatGrandparentIDField
fields
private java.lang.String[] fields
fieldLables
private java.lang.String[] fieldLables
displayFields
private java.lang.String[] displayFields
searchableFields
private java.lang.String[] searchableFields
searchableIntFields
private java.lang.String[] searchableIntFields
cantSortByFields
private java.lang.String[] cantSortByFields
itemsPerPage
private java.lang.String itemsPerPage
firstRow
private java.lang.String firstRow
searchString
private java.lang.String searchString
sortByString
private java.lang.String sortByString
sortAscOrDesc
private java.lang.String sortAscOrDesc
editMode
private java.lang.String editMode
outputMode
private java.lang.String outputMode
formAction
private java.lang.String formAction
addFormAction
private java.lang.String addFormAction
editFormAction
private java.lang.String editFormAction
editDeleteFormAction
private java.lang.String editDeleteFormAction
childEditAction
private java.lang.String childEditAction
assignments
private java.lang.String assignments
parentName
private java.lang.String parentName
grandparentName
private java.lang.String grandparentName
greatGrandparentName
private java.lang.String greatGrandparentName
deleteID
private java.lang.String[] deleteID
assigned
private java.lang.String[] assigned
parentScreen
private java.lang.String parentScreen
formUtils
private FormUtils formUtils
BaseSerializableForm
public BaseSerializableForm()
isM2mChild
public boolean isM2mChild()
setM2mChild
public void setM2mChild(boolean child)
getParentName
public java.lang.String getParentName()
setParentName
public void setParentName(java.lang.String parentName)
getGrandparentName
public java.lang.String getGrandparentName()
setGrandparentName
public void setGrandparentName(java.lang.String grandparentName)
getGreatGrandparentName
public java.lang.String getGreatGrandparentName()
setGreatGrandparentName
public void setGreatGrandparentName(java.lang.String greatGrandparentName)
getCantSortByFields
public java.lang.String[] getCantSortByFields()
setCantSortByFields
public void setCantSortByFields(java.lang.String[] cantSortByFields)
getAssignments
public java.lang.String getAssignments()
setAssignments
public void setAssignments(java.lang.String assignments)
getDeleteID
public java.lang.String[] getDeleteID()
setDeleteID
public void setDeleteID(java.lang.String[] deleteID)
getAssigned
public java.lang.String[] getAssigned()
setAssigned
public void setAssigned(java.lang.String[] assigned)
getIdField
public java.lang.String getIdField()
setIdField
public void setIdField(java.lang.String idField)
getParentIDField
public java.lang.String getParentIDField()
setParentIDField
public void setParentIDField(java.lang.String parentIDField)
getGrandparentIDField
public java.lang.String getGrandparentIDField()
setGrandparentIDField
public void setGrandparentIDField(java.lang.String grandparentIDField)
getGreatGrandparentIDField
public java.lang.String getGreatGrandparentIDField()
setGreatGrandparentIDField
public void setGreatGrandparentIDField(java.lang.String greatGrandparentIDField)
getFields
public java.lang.String[] getFields()
setFields
public void setFields(java.lang.String[] fields)
getFieldLables
public java.lang.String[] getFieldLables()
setFieldLables
public void setFieldLables(java.lang.String[] fieldLables)
getDisplayFields
public java.lang.String[] getDisplayFields()
setDisplayFields
public void setDisplayFields(java.lang.String[] displayFields)
getItemsPerPage
public java.lang.String getItemsPerPage()
setItemsPerPage
public void setItemsPerPage(java.lang.String itemsPerPage)
getFirstRow
public java.lang.String getFirstRow()
setFirstRow
public void setFirstRow(java.lang.String firstRow)
getSearchString
public java.lang.String getSearchString()
setSearchString
public void setSearchString(java.lang.String searchString)
getEntity
public java.lang.Class getEntity()
setEntity
public void setEntity(java.lang.Class entity)
getManyToManyKey
public java.lang.String getManyToManyKey()
setManyToManyKey
public void setManyToManyKey(java.lang.String manyToManyKey)
getManyToManyProp
public java.lang.String getManyToManyProp()
setManyToManyProp
public void setManyToManyProp(java.lang.String manyToManyProp)
getParentID
public java.lang.String getParentID()
setParentID
public void setParentID(java.lang.String parentID)
getSearchableFields
public java.lang.String[] getSearchableFields()
setSearchableFields
public void setSearchableFields(java.lang.String[] searchableFields)
getSearchableIntFields
public java.lang.String[] getSearchableIntFields()
setSearchableIntFields
public void setSearchableIntFields(java.lang.String[] searchableIntFields)
getSortByString
public java.lang.String getSortByString()
setSortByString
public void setSortByString(java.lang.String sortByString)
getSortAscOrDesc
public java.lang.String getSortAscOrDesc()
setSortAscOrDesc
public void setSortAscOrDesc(java.lang.String sortAscOrDesc)
getEditMode
public java.lang.String getEditMode()
setEditMode
public void setEditMode(java.lang.String editMode)
getOutputMode
public java.lang.String getOutputMode()
setOutputMode
public void setOutputMode(java.lang.String outputMode)
getFormAction
public java.lang.String getFormAction()
setFormAction
public void setFormAction(java.lang.String formAction)
getAddFormAction
public java.lang.String getAddFormAction()
setAddFormAction
public void setAddFormAction(java.lang.String addFormAction)
getEditDeleteFormAction
public java.lang.String getEditDeleteFormAction()
setEditDeleteFormAction
public void setEditDeleteFormAction(java.lang.String editDeleteFormAction)
getEditFormAction
public java.lang.String getEditFormAction()
setEditFormAction
public void setEditFormAction(java.lang.String editFormAction)
getChildEditAction
public java.lang.String getChildEditAction()
setChildEditAction
public void setChildEditAction(java.lang.String childEditAction)
getManyToManyClass
public java.lang.String getManyToManyClass()
setManyToManyClass
public void setManyToManyClass(java.lang.String manyToManyClass)
getParentKey
public java.lang.String getParentKey()
setParentKey
public void setParentKey(java.lang.String parentKey)
getIdValues
public java.lang.String[] getIdValues()
setIdValues
public void setIdValues(java.lang.String[] idValues)
getIdIntegers
public java.lang.Integer[] getIdIntegers()
setIdIntegers
public void setIdIntegers(java.lang.Integer[] idIntegers)
getEntityProperty
public java.lang.String getEntityProperty()
setEntityProperty
public void setEntityProperty(java.lang.String entityProperty)
getParentProperty
public java.lang.String getParentProperty()
setParentProperty
public void setParentProperty(java.lang.String parentProperty)
getChildName
public java.lang.String getChildName()
setChildName
public void setChildName(java.lang.String childName)
getNameField
public java.lang.String getNameField()
setNameField
public void setNameField(java.lang.String nameField)
getParentScreen
public java.lang.String getParentScreen()
setParentScreen
public void setParentScreen(java.lang.String parentScreen)
getJoinManyToManyParent
public java.lang.String getJoinManyToManyParent()
setJoinManyToManyParent
public void setJoinManyToManyParent(java.lang.String joinManyToManyParent)
getFormUtils
public FormUtils getFormUtils(javax.servlet.http.HttpServletRequest request)
setProperties
public void setProperties(javax.servlet.http.HttpServletRequest request)
arrayAppend
public java.lang.String[] arrayAppend(java.lang.String[] array,
java.lang.String item)
arrayPrepend
public java.lang.String[] arrayPrepend(java.lang.String[] array,
java.lang.String item)
arrayRemove
public java.lang.String[] arrayRemove(java.lang.String[] array,
java.lang.String item)
containsUnsafeCharacter
public java.lang.Character containsUnsafeCharacter(java.lang.String string,
javax.servlet.http.HttpServletRequest request)
Copyright © SoftSlate, LLC 20032005